After weeks of delays and infighting the United States House of Representatives have elected a new Speaker of the House. After the second Republican Speaker nominee Tom Emmer withdrew from contention House Republicans met again and nominated Congressman Mike Johnson of Louisiana. Minnesota DNR restricting access to off road trails during deer season 

The Minnesota Department of Natural Resources wants to remind offroaders that recreational use of off-highway vehicles will be restricted on some state forest trails and access routes during the upcoming firearms deer hunting season.  The restrictions will not apply to state forest roads, and the goal of these restrictions is to protect recreational riders from…
